Output 81b267649323f8393840e003bda30932fb38ea36c00484274e61c41eeec230f0:0

value
3285825
script pubkey
OP_HASH160 OP_PUSHBYTES_20 59b8be5983671e39013ff932cddcfd83a5a07c49 OP_EQUAL
address
39sRNpjTZEwwUDkutwb1RYiosadqojC73L
transaction
81b267649323f8393840e003bda30932fb38ea36c00484274e61c41eeec230f0
spent
true